What is Computer?

A computer is actually a programmable machine which is capable of performing given mathematical and logical operations in sequence automatically. It can be directed in a planned manner to perform numerical, logical operations and various other types of calculations accurately. This instruction is called computer programming. The computer understands the instructions of the user with the help of computer programming language.

  2. Who is computer father?

    Charles Babbage (born December 26, 1791, London, England—died October 18, 1871, London), was an philosopher, english polymath, mathematician, inventor and mechanical engineer. He originated the concept of a digital programmable computer. He is considered by some to be “father of the computer”.

  3. Who is mother of computer?

    Ada Lovelace is mother of computer. She was an english mathematician and writer, chiefly known for her work on charles Charles Babbage’s proposed mechanical general purpose computer, the analytical engine.
